Trouble is a manufacturer will probably say no even if it does work because they wont guarantee something when you could turn round and say it blew up your computer and burnt down you house and its their fault.
Best way to find out is to try it and see because unless someone who visits here has attempted it the likelyhood of you finding out is low. The Digits of the two cards add up but still its a suck it and see trial.
Lastly why go down? I had 2 8700M GT's in SLI and a 9700 is just a relabed 8700 and trust me two were dire so one is going to be no improvement and if its battery life you seek that is not the laptop for it.
I would go with a 260M if I were you its a very good card and still handles games quick comfortably at mid range settings. -

If someone is having the same problem, 9700m gt will not fit. that is the same card that will fit m50 i think... they at least look alike. so only cards available for this machine is 9800m gs or 260m ? (asus reversed mxm ones from g50/g60)
